如何使用组策略控制 Outlook 自动发现

原始 KB 编号: 2612922

摘要

在 组策略 对象编辑器中查看 Outlook 策略设置时,只会看到与自动发现相关的以下策略设置:

基于 Active Directory 主 SMTP 地址自动配置配置文件

但是,此策略设置仅控制当 Microsoft Exchange 邮箱信息可用于已加入域的工作站时是否显示启动向导对话框。

在某些情况下,你可能希望控制 Outlook 用于查找自动发现服务的方法。 这取决于客户端/服务器拓扑,但 Outlook 使用的方法如下:

SCP 查找
HTTPS 根域查询
HTTPS 自动发现域查询
HTTP 重定向方法
SRV 记录查询

默认情况下,Outlook 使用一个或多个这些方法访问自动发现服务。 例如,对于未加入域的计算机,Outlook 会尝试连接到预定义 URL (例如, https://autodiscover.contoso.com/autodiscover/autodiscover.xml 使用 DNS) 。 如果失败,Outlook 会尝试 HTTP 重定向方法。 如果不起作用,Outlook 会尝试使用 SRV 记录查找方法。 如果所有查找方法都失败,Outlook 无法获取“Outlook Anywhere”配置和 URL 设置。

本文讨论如何启用或禁用自动发现功能,以及如何指定 Outlook 尝试访问自动发现服务的方法。

更多信息

若要部署自定义组策略模板来控制 Outlook 自动发现功能的行为,请执行以下步骤:

  1. 从 Microsoft 下载中心下载并提取 Outlook 版本的自定义组策略模板:

  2. 将步骤 1 中下载的 .adm 或 .admx 文件复制到域控制器:

    注意

    将 .adm 或 .admx 文件添加到域控制器的步骤因你运行的 Windows 版本而异。 此外,由于你可能将策略应用于组织单位 (OU) 而不是整个域,因此在应用策略方面的步骤可能会有所不同。 因此,检查 Windows 文档了解详细信息。

  3. 在“ 用户配置”下,展开“经典管理模板” (ADM) 或基于 XML 的管理模板 (ADMX) ,找到模板的策略节点。

  4. 若要配置自动发现功能,请找到 Exchange 节点。 在 Exchange 节点中,选择 “自动发现 ”节点。 在详细信息窗格中双击 “自动发现 ”策略设置。

  5. 在策略设置的对话框中,选择 “已启用” 以启用策略。

    注意

    启用策略设置时,将选中此项下的五个“排除检查框。 若要禁用自动发现功能,请确保选中所有检查框。 或者,可以使用五个检查框来指定 Outlook 自动发现用来尝试访问自动发现服务的发现方法。

  6. 配置完自动发现策略并且信息已传播到 Outlook 客户端后,可以通过检查注册表中的以下子项来验证策略是否可用于 Outlook:

    HKEY_CURRENT_USER\Software\Policies\Microsoft\Office\<x.0>\Outlook\AutoDiscover

    注意

    <x.0> 占位符表示您的 Outlook 版本 (12.0 = Outlook 2007、14.0 = Outlook 2010、15.0 = Outlook 2013 和 16.0 = Outlook 2016、Outlook 2019 和 Microsoft 365 专属 Outlook) 。

用于尝试访问自动发现服务的方法

SCP 对象查找

Outlook 对服务连接点执行 Active Directory 查询, (SCP) 对象。

基于主 SMTP 地址的根域查询

Outlook 使用主 SMTP 地址的根域来尝试查找自动发现服务。 Outlook 尝试基于 SMTP 地址连接到以下 URL:

https://<smtp-address-domain>/autodiscover/autodiscover.xml

查询自动发现域

Outlook 使用自动发现域来尝试查找自动发现服务。 Outlook 尝试基于 SMTP 地址连接到以下 URL:

https://autodiscover.<smtp-address-domain>/autodiscover/autodiscover.xml

HTTP 重定向

如果 Outlook 无法通过任一安全 HTTPS URL 访问自动发现服务,Outlook 将使用 HTTP 重定向:

https://<smtp-address-domain>/autodiscover/autodiscover.xml

https://autodiscover.<smtp-address-domain>/autodiscover/autodiscover.xml

DNS 中的 SRV 记录查询

Outlook 使用 DNS 中的 SRV 记录查找来尝试查找自动发现服务。